Early life and education

GVK Reddy was born on 22 March 1937 in Kottur village in Nellore district of Andhra Pradesh. He received his early education there and later graduated from Osmania University, Hyderabad. He received the ‘Owner/President Management Program’ from Harvard Business School, United States of America. which gave global expansion to his business vision.

Establishment and success of GVK Group

Reddy started his career as a contractor. He founded GVK Group in the 1990s. His first major success came when he set up India’s first private sector gas-based power plant at Jegumpadu, Andhra Pradesh. This was a new beginning of private participation in India’s energy sector.

Revolution in aviation and infrastructure

GVK Reddy is most famous for the modernization of Mumbai International Airport (CSMIA). Under his leadership, Mumbai Airport’s ‘Terminal 2’ (T2) was completed, which is today counted among the most beautiful and efficient airports in the world. Apart from this, he also played an important role in the development of Bengaluru Airport. GVK Group also set new records under his supervision in sectors like roads, energy, hospitality and life sciences.

Social service and respect

Apart from business, Reddy social service Have also been leading in. Through GVK Foundation, he has done unprecedented work in the fields of education, health and rural development. Especially ‘108 Ambulance Service’ He has made a big contribution in making it modern and accessible. The Government of India awarded him the Padma Bhushan for his valuable contributions in the field of trade and industry.
